About NORTH HILLS MOTORS OF RALEIGH INC

North Hills Motors of Raleigh is a car dealer located at 5108 Western Blvd in Raleigh, NC. The dealership provides used car sales, vehicle service, and automotive repairs to the local community. Customers can visit the showroom Monday through Friday from 9:00 AM to 6:00 PM and on Saturdays from 10:00 AM to 5:30 PM.

North Hills Motors of Raleigh operates as a full-service outlet for pre-owned vehicles. The business maintains an on-site service department to assist with maintenance and repair needs after a vehicle purchase. Prospective buyers can contact the dealership at 919-834-4444 to discuss inventory or financing options.

1.0Abigail Antoine2 months ago

I don’t usually leave negative reviews, but I feel obligated to share my experience so others can make an informed decision. I bought a used vehicle from this dealership in 2023 and understood it was being sold “as is.” My issue isn’t that used cars need repairs—it’s the lack of honesty, professionalism, and accountability I experienced. During the sale, I was verbally assured the car ran well and was told I would have warranty coverage, including tire protection through Discount Tire. When I later called about those promises, I was told no such warranty existed and that they didn’t believe anyone had ever said that. Less than a year after purchasing the car, I had major brake issues. When I called the dealership, I wasn’t asking for a free repair—I was simply looking for guidance. Instead, I was blamed for not maintaining my vehicle, even though I had only owned it for a few months. I remained calm throughout the conversation, but after saying, “That’s fine, I’ll just leave a review,” they called me back and I was yelled at and accused of trying to tear down their business. That response alone spoke volumes about their professionalism. Since buying the car, I’ve had to repair my brakes roughly every six months, costing me thousands of dollars. I understand that repairs happen, but this has been excessive for the amount I’ve driven, and even another independent shop has questioned how frequently I’ve needed brake work. Looking back, I know I should have gotten every promise in writing. I was 19 years old buying my first car, and my mom and I had limited options. I trusted the salesperson’s word, and unfortunately, I learned an expensive lesson. If you’re considering buying from this dealership, I encourage you to read the lower-rated reviews as well as the positive ones. Pay attention not only to the complaints but also to how the dealership responds to them. My experience wasn’t just disappointing because of the car—it was the way I was treated afterward that ensured I would never do business here again.
